Silver is the metal that gets you wolf armour, a silver sword and the draugr fang bow. It is also completely invisible until you have the right tool.
You need the wishbone first
The Wishbone drops from Bonemass. Equip it in your utility slot and it pings when you are near something buried. There is no practical way to find silver without it.
Hunting a deposit
- Go to the Mountains with frost resistance sorted.
- Walk the slopes with the
Wishbone equipped and listen. The ping speeds up as you close in.
- When it is rapid and the visual effect is strongest, start digging with a pickaxe.
- Silver sits in large veins, so once you break through, keep digging. One deposit is worth a lot.
Watch the terrain while you dig
Digging into a mountainside can drop you into a hole you cannot climb out of, or collapse you onto a slope. Also, the noise attracts wolves. Clear the area first.

Getting it home
Silver cannot go through portals. Mountains are usually far from home, so the standard approach is a small outpost partway down with a chest, then a cart or boat run. See the sailing guide for hauling.
What to make first
- Wolf armour, which also solves the cold permanently.
- Draugr fang bow, the best bow for a long stretch of the game.
- Silver sword, especially strong against the undead.
With silver gear you are ready for Moder, and after that the Plains.
